Tonight I took down a section of 80D nail that calibrates at 615. Finally busted the 600 barrier! I'm so pleased for so many different reasons. First of all, I've been bending for six years and recently went 2 1/2 years without improvement. Secondly, I think I was about 20 pounds heavier when I last set a PR (I now weigh 185). Furthermore, I'm now adhering to the 3 minute time limit and 1 1/4" wrap width limit of The Steel Slayers list.

I think what finally got me on the ball to start improving again was The Steel Slayer list itself, as well as the bending contest I recently hosted. In short, the ol' cliche: GOALS.

Also, I was a little hesitant to get on the list with a nail, but I calibrated three of these nails attaining figures of 615, 620, and 615. That degree of consistency with nails was pretty surprising.

I think I might join CaptainCrush in his pursuit of a KOAB cert. I think I have a couple left that calibrate at 665 lbs. I would probably have to use thicker pads to get it done any time in the immediate future, but maybe not. I've never even tried crush down pads, so that might help me the most, as my crush is by far my weakest portion of the bend. As Gazza has said before, stainless would be a good training tool for improving the crush.

Congrats Eric. Are you doing anything different (besides having a goal) from what you've been doing for the past 2 years?

No, I'm really not. Part of it must be the fact that I lost a good deal of motivation to push my bending and now have that motivation back. Enthusiasm is everything when it comes to bending. At the other end of the spectrum I would place thick bar (for me personally, anyways). My thick bar seems to respond solely to my training habits, whereas bending, because it takes such an intense and extended effort, is very dependent on my drive and excitement level.
